The Secret He Couldn't Keep Chapter 1

I matured faster than other girls my age.

At my eighteenth birthday party, my overprotective brother, Cole, asked his best friend to watch over me.

But from the moment we met, the man’s eyes burned with a raw desire. His gaze was a thorny vine that wrapped around me and wouldn't let go.

After graduating from college, I became his senior executive assistant. By day, he was my boss. By night, he was the lover who claimed my body.

For four years, we carried on this secret affair.

He molded me into the woman he desired, and I mistook his control for love.

Then one day, his ex-fiancée, Cassidy Hayes, returned from Europe. Without a second thought, he left my bed in the middle of the night to pick her up from the airport.

Humiliated and furious, I still followed him like some pathetic puppy, only to watch him tenderly kiss another woman on a park bench.

He turned, saw me, and sneered, "This was never anything more than a game, Willow Ashton. And you... you look pathetic."

The more tenderly he looked at her, the more cruelly he mocked me.

That's when it hit me. He was right. None of this had ever meant a thing.

So I lowered my head, sent a text to Cole accepting the arranged marriage with the Lancaster family, then looked up at the man with a smile more liberating than any I’d worn in four years.

"Fine. We're done."

————————

1

It wasn't long before Cole Ashton called.

Even over the phone, I could hear the relief in his voice. He assumed I had finally moved on from the man I’d loved for years.

What he didn't know was that the man I was madly in love with... was his best friend, Rhys Sterling.

After hanging up, I grabbed the resignation letter I had already prepared and headed to the HR department. However, the process stalled at the very last step.

"Ms. Ashton, because yours is a core position, an exit within the week requires the CEO's personal signature for approval," the HR Director said, an apologetic look on her face.

Of course. Rhys. Even now, at the very end, I couldn't escape him.

I clutched my phone, walked to the end of the empty hallway, and dialed the number I knew by heart.

The phone rang for what felt like an eternity.

Just as I thought it would go to voicemail, the call connected. But the voice that answered wasn't his deep timber—it was a woman's, light and unfamiliar.

"Hello? Looking for Rhys? He's in the shower..."

In the shower.

The words were a thousand poisoned needles lancing through my chest. Despite this, years of professional training kept my voice steady, almost detached.

"Never mind. Thank you."

I hung up before she could say another word. The dark screen reflected my pale, drawn face.

Less than two minutes later, my phone buzzed violently. I stared at Rhys's name on the screen for a few seconds, took a deep breath, and answered.

"What is it?"

His tone was all business, cold and distant. Just last night, this same man had been on top of me, whispering my name like a prayer.

My knuckles whitened around the resignation letter.

"Mr. Sterling, I have a personnel change document that requires your signature."

He let out a low "Mm," then added as an afterthought, "Oh, right. Come by later and pack up your things. Cassidy is moving in."

"My place on the West Side is empty. You can move in there." His tone was infuriatingly casual, a thin veil for his patronizing pity. "I promised Cole I'd take care of you."

Four years ago, he'd drunkenly pulled me into his bed and made me his mistress. Four years later, to make room for the rightful lady of the house, he was offering me a new cage, cloaking it as a duty to his best friend.

The sheer audacity of his "kindness" was laughable.

"That won't be necessary, Mr. Sterling," I said, forcing a smile. "I'm an adult. I can take care of myself."

Once he signed the letter and I completed the final handover, our absurd four-year charade would be over for good.

And me? I was getting married.
